reaction
Signification (Anglais)
- An action or statement in response to a stimulus or other event.
- A transformation in which one or more substances is converted into another by combination or decomposition.
- Reactionary politics; a period in which reactionary thought or politics is resurgent or dominant.
- Unpurposeful behavior.
- An icon or emoji appended to a posted message by a user to express their feeling about it.

Étymologie (Anglais)
Inherited from Middle English reaccion, from Old French reaction, from Latin reāctiō, from the verb reagō, from re- (“again”) + agō (“to act”); more at re-, action; equivalent to react + -ion.
